Wayland is a locality in Middlesex County, Massachusetts, United States. It has a population of 13,900. The population density is 480.0 people per km². Wayland is located at 42.3626°N, 71.3614°W. It observes the Eastern Time (America/New_York) timezone. ZIP code: 01778.

Wayland emerged from early colonial roots as a settlement defined by agrarian labor and the slow accumulation of homesteads. Over generations, the local economy shifted from the traditional cultivation of soil to a diverse network of professional services and residential support. Small businesses and local enterprises sustain the daily needs of the residents, maintaining a steady, functional vitality. The influence of the nearby Bedford Levels remains visible in the low-lying topography that once dictated the placement of early roads and mills. Craftsmanship and intellectual inquiry have long replaced the initial industrial focus, favoring an economy built on education and technical expertise. This evolution reflects a broader regional commitment to stability and the careful stewardship of available resources.

Wayland fosters a cultural character that prizes quiet reflection and a deep connection to the regional heritage. The presence of the First Parish Church serves as a landmark of architectural endurance, standing as a witness to the community’s long-standing social traditions. Seasonal events draw neighbors together in open spaces, celebrating the transition of the calendar without the need for grand spectacles. Notable figures, such as the social reformer Lydia Maria Child, once found inspiration in the local environment, leaving a legacy of advocacy that resonates in the civic life of the area. Public spaces provide a venue for the arts and community dialogue, reinforcing a sense of shared purpose. The rhythm of daily existence here is marked by the changing seasons and a persistent, grounded devotion to the life of the mind.
